L'Elche Club de Fútbol, noto semplicemente come Elche (in catalano Elx Club de Futbol), è una società calcistica spagnola con sede nella città di Elche, nella Comunità Valenciana. Milita in Primera División, il massimo livello del campionato spagnolo di calcio.
Fondata nel 1923, la squadra gioca le partite casalinghe allo Stadio Manuel Martínez Valero, impianto da 33 732 posti. Conta 21 partecipazioni alla Primera División, la massima serie nazionale.

It is the home stadium of Elche CF, a team that is currently playing in La Liga Segunda División. Its name pays tribute to the late president of the club, Manuel Martínez Valero. It hosted the largest rout in the finals of a World Cup and hosted the final of the Copa del Rey in 2003. The Spanish football team has played several friendly matches and competitive qualifiers there.
